20120289821 | C-ARM INTEGRATED ELECTROMAGNETIC TRACKING SYSTEM - A medical imaging system and a method electromagnetically track a position of structures with the medical imaging system and a C-arm arrangement. The medical imaging system contains a C-arm, a gantry, and at least one electromagnetic field generator assembly with at least one electromagnetic field generator which interacts with an electromagnetic sensor from receiving the electromagnetic radiation. Preferably, the electromagnetic sensor is positioned within a region of surgical interest in a patient. The electromagnetic field generator is directly embedded into the C-arm. | 11-15-2012 |
20120289826 | METHOD FOR LOCALIZATION AND IDENTIFICATION OF STRUCTURES IN PROJECTION IMAGES - A method for localization and identification of a structure in a projection image with a system having a known system geometry, includes acquiring a preoperative computer-tomography or CT image of a structure, preprocessing the CT-image to a volume image, acquiring an intraoperative two dimensional or 2D X-ray image, preprocessing the 2D X-ray image to a fix image, estimating an approximate pose of the structure, calculating a digitally reconstructed radiograph or DRR using the volume image, the estimated pose and the system geometry, and calculating a correlation between the generated DRR and the fix image, with a correlation value representing matching between the generated DRR and the fix image. The method significantly decreases the number of wrong-level surgeries and is independent of the surgeon's ability to localize and/or identify a target level in a body. | 11-15-2012 |
20140334709 | 3D-2D IMAGE REGISTRATION FOR MEDICAL IMAGING - A method of 3D-2D registration for medical imaging includes the following steps: providing a first input interface for acquiring a three-dimensional image; providing a second input interface for acquiring a fixed two-dimensional image using an imaging system that includes a source and a detector and that has an unknown source-detector geometry; initializing image transformation parameters and source-detector geometry parameters; generating a reconstructed two-dimensional image from the three-dimensional image using the image transformation parameters and the source-detector geometry parameters; determining an image similarity metric between the fixed two-dimensional image and the reconstructed two-dimensional image; and updating the image transformation parameters and the source-detector geometry parameters using the image similarity metric, and a corresponding non-transitory computer-readable medium and apparatus. | 11-13-2014 |
20150085981 | METHOD OF IMAGE REGISTRATION IN A MULTI-SOURCE/SINGLE DETECTOR RADIOGRAPHIC IMAGING SYSTEM, AND IMAGE ACQUISITION APPARATUS - A method, an imaging apparatus and a computer readable medium are enabled for automatically registering medical images. The imaging apparatus may be an amended C-arm. The image acquisition apparatus has a primary x-ray source and at least one auxiliary x-ray source, a detector for receiving radiation of the primary and auxiliary x-ray source, and an interface to a registration unit. The registration unit computes a 3D/2D registration of a provided 3D image and at least two acquired 2D images. An output interface is configured to provide an output and to display the registered images on a monitor. | 03-26-2015 |
